Three Chargers Ranked Among the NFL’s Top 100

The Los Angeles Chargers players were ranked among the NFL’s top 100 players of 2017 according to this list produced by NFL.com and voted upon by NFL players. It should come as no surprise that the Chargers who made the list were breakout star cornerback Casey Hayward, rookie star pass rusher Joey Bosa, and the Chargers’ all-time leading passer Philip Rivers.

Bosa just made the list at #100 which seems rather uncharitable given that he was the Chargers’ best player last season. Rivers came in at #73 despite one of the worst seasons of his career. And Hayward was ranked 64th after leading the NFL in interceptions.

There were two notable omissions in Melvin Ingram and Melvin Gordon. You could make an argument that either could or should have been among the top 100, but the Chargers were an awful football team that finished with one of the worst records in the NFL and neither player was so good that you ought to feel compelled to make the case for them as the fourth or fifth Charger to be represented on this sort of list.
